Abstract | In recent years, the demand of in-class interaction and assessment for learning is rising. There
is more emphasis on using electronic tools for assessment for learning in order to facilitate
teachers seeking to identify and diagnose student learning problems, and providing quality
feedback for students on how to improve their work. This paper discusses the challenges of eassessment
and introduced a few e-assessment tools developed in Hong Kong. These tools
include classroom interaction, peer review module, real-time quiz with analytic and a penbased
home feedback system. The tools can provide an efficient and effective channel for
providing feedback so as to monitor any learning difficulties and help teachers to diagnose
students’ prior skills and abilities, providing feedback for them to adjust the curriculum or
provide additional assistance accordingly. |
